Output 23ea631e6cf5f36727909e161422142348f66b5fab78ce6f254a80870827d42f:0

value
49659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c5428d2ea99cc8d5da8d3966fab1fc76b6b29dd OP_EQUAL
address
3A7CuhEdvLQPatypXxokMVU3EZ4QA9A5Mx
transaction
23ea631e6cf5f36727909e161422142348f66b5fab78ce6f254a80870827d42f
confirmations
234450
spent
true